I heard another driftnet beacon last night, stumbled onto it on 1752 kHz. It sent "92S161 <short dash>" 5 times in a row, then would wait 3 minutes and send it again. I listened for 20 minutes to get the cycle down. This was a true CW beacon, with just a keyed carrier. The other one I heard had an unmodulated carrier on 1736 with the ident "GW5 <dash>" on 1737.0--like a standard NDB.
